Little League Football Coach Killed

Birmingham's 55th homicide victim was killed before 9 Thursday night in the 4100 block of 39th Avenue. In Bessemer, he's remembered as a hero.

Demetrius Reigns coached the McAdory Yellow Jackets little league football team. They are a group of five and six-year olds with a lot of heart in the Bessemer community.

'The First 48' crews, along with Birmingham police, documented Reigns' murder.

"He was all about family -- if it was his own family or his football family, he was building a house in the community he really just loved the kids," said Reigns' friend, Jason Hudgins.

Dozens of families prayed and paid respects to the man who spent several days a week coaching football and giving back to the community. As police search for the coach's killer, Yellow Jacket parents are figuring out a way to explain death to their five-year-olds.
